The average train between Soham and King's Lynn takes 50 min and the fastest train takes 44 min. The train service runs several times per day from Soham to King's Lynn.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run every 4 hours between Soham and King's Lynn. The earliest departure is at 6:49 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Soham is at 8:51 PM which arrives into King's Lynn at 9:38 PM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 50 min.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

The distance between Soham and King's Lynn is 46.7 km. The road distance is 51 km.
Great Northern operates a train from Ely to Kings Lynn hourly. Tickets cost £12–28 and the journey takes 35 min.
